The Pellworth satellite office will close at the end of Q2. Nine staff are affected: six transfer to the Granbury site, three take voluntary packages. Annualised savings are projected at roughly 4% of regional operating cost, net of lease break fees and relocation. The landlord, Hartwick Estates, has agreed early termination terms. Finance should model cash impact across two quarters and reclassify the remaining equipment. The confidential note below sets out the related expansion plan.

management briefing: Gross margin on Ralwyn came in at 5 percent against a plan of 5 percent. Only 3 of the 120 pilot accounts renewed Ralwyn, so a churn review is set for January 1.

## Service Account: cal-sync-bot

When Fernwick Calendar and the Tillamost booking tool both write to the same event slot, the sync bot flags a conflict and pauses that account's queue. Support can resume the queue after verifying with the customer which entry is authoritative. Resuming requires a call to the internal Schedsync API, authenticated as the cal-sync-bot service account with the key below.

service key, fawip-bajef: kto11_Qt5wZK9vdNC

Before promoting a PickRoute build to the Kestrelmoor fulfillment cluster, confirm the batch scheduler is drained and no pick-lists are mid-optimization. The optimizer reads its tuning parameters at startup only, so any change requires a rolling restart of all three worker nodes. Verify zone-weighting tables were migrated in the prior release; mismatched tables cause silent routing regressions. Once drained, apply the release artifact and restart workers in order. The service must start with the following configuration values.

deployment values, fahap-hahaf:
[casdor]
port = 9200
region = south-2
host = casdor.qirvanworks.corp
timeout_ms = 3000
retries = 4

## Changelog — Fareloom Rules Engine v3.8.1

### Key rotation

As part of the quarterly schedule, the signing key for Fareloom rule-pack artifacts was rotated. All shipping-fee rule bundles published after this release are signed with the new key; bundles signed with the retired key remain valid until end of quarter. New team members should update their local verification config before pulling rule packs. For convenience, the current public signing key is included below.

deploy key for yajop-fahop: bky3_h1v